Vigo County Background Check Lookup
Vigo County background check records are held at the courthouse in Terre Haute, Indiana. With about 107,000 residents, Vigo County is one of the larger counties in the western part of the state. The Clerk of the Circuit Court manages all court files, and the Terre Haute Police Department keeps its own set of records for city-level incidents. You can search Vigo County records online through MyCase, visit the clerk's office in person, or contact the sheriff for law enforcement data. Court cases, arrest records, and traffic filings all factor into a background check from Vigo County.

Vigo County Clerk of Courts
The Clerk of the Circuit Court in Vigo County is the official record keeper for all court files in the area. This office sits in the Vigo County courthouse in Terre Haute. Staff handle filings, issue court papers, collect fines and fees, and store all case documents. For a background check in Vigo County, the clerk's office is where you get court records, case details, and certified copies of judgments.
The Vigo County Clerk's Office is open on weekdays. Standard copies cost $1.00 per page, and certified copies carry an added fee. Bring cash or a money order since not all courts in Indiana take personal checks. You can also search Vigo County records through the MyCase website without going to the courthouse. For written requests, the clerk must respond within 7 days under Indiana Code 5-14-3, which governs public access to records.
Vigo County has both a Circuit Court and Superior Courts. Cases are spread across these courts based on type. Criminal felonies, misdemeanors, civil matters, family cases, and small claims are all part of the system. Each of these case types can show up in a background check run through Vigo County.

Vigo County Sheriff Records
The Vigo County Sheriff's Office handles law enforcement outside the Terre Haute city limits. The sheriff runs the county jail, serves legal papers, and keeps arrest records. For a background check in Vigo County, the sheriff's office can provide info on arrests, warrants, and inmate data that the court system may not have yet.
The Terre Haute Police Department covers the city itself. Their records division handles incident reports and local police data. If the person you are checking on lives in Terre Haute, police records from the city may be separate from what the Vigo County sheriff has on file. Both sources are worth checking for a complete background check. The Terre Haute Police Department website has info on how to request records from their office.
The Indiana ISP limited criminal history search is another useful tool for people looking at Vigo County records.
This statewide tool pulls from a central database and covers all of Indiana, not just Vigo County.
Note: The Indiana VINE system at 866-959-VINE (8463) lets you track an inmate's custody status in Vigo County at any time of day.
Search Vigo County Background Check Online
The MyCase online portal is the primary tool for searching Vigo County background check records from home. Indiana's statewide system covers all 92 counties. Search by party name, case number, or attorney name. Basic lookups cost nothing.
For a deeper check, the Indiana State Police Limited Criminal History portal costs $15 for subscribers or $16.32 without an account. You can mail in a request for $7. This search covers the full state criminal database, which catches records from any Indiana county, not just Vigo County. Under Indiana Code Title 35, criminal records follow specific rules about access and privacy.
Some records are restricted. Juvenile cases stay sealed. Adoption files are private. Mental health proceedings and expunged records under Indiana's Second Chance Law (Indiana Code 35-38-9) will not show up in a Vigo County background check.
Vigo County Background Check Fees
Court record copies from Vigo County cost $1.00 per page. Certified copies are more. The clerk may charge a search fee if staff have to dig through files on your behalf. Credit card payments typically come with a 3.5% service charge.
The statewide ISP criminal history check costs between $7 and $16.32 depending on method. Cities in Vigo County
Vigo County is home to Terre Haute, the county seat and largest city in the area with about 58,000 people. West Terre Haute and other smaller communities also fall under Vigo County jurisdiction. All criminal and civil cases in these areas go through the Vigo County courts.
